Add convenience methods to Comment objects Add String() to print out the Comment, Text() to print out the Comment while stripping /*, //, and */, and EndLine() to return the line number of the last line of the comment. Change-Id: I076bc0990143acfc03c42a8cc569894fced8ee24
Blueprint is a meta-build system that reads in Blueprints files that describe modules that need to be built, and produces a Ninja manifest describing the commands that need to be run and their dependencies. Where most build systems use built-in rules or a domain-specific language to describe the logic for converting module descriptions to build rules, Blueprint delegates this to per-project build logic written in Go. For large, heterogenous projects this allows the inherent complexity of the build logic to be maintained in a high-level language, while still allowing simple changes to individual modules by modifying easy to understand Blueprints files.
